Description

The Senior Teller position will be responsible for greeting members and potential members, identifying their perceived and unperceived needs and process transactions promptly and accurately. This position utilizes a thorough credit union product knowledge, exceptional cross selling and service skills and a professional demeanor to assist each member. The Senior Teller performs exceptional service, working both independently and as a team and serves as a leader and role model for other members of the organization and performs as a strong backup to the Assistant Branch Manager.

What will you be doing?

  • Serve as the face of the organization and provide exceptional service to the members of Climb Credit Union.
  • Assist the Assistant Branch Manager with scheduling, training, and coaching the other tellers, assists with performance reviews, maintains the branch's monthly audit requirements.
  • Learn about our members by listening to them and developing a relation with them.
  • Deepen and strengthen the relationship with the member by educating them on our products and services.
  • Process transactions such as deposits, withdrawals, transfers, loan payments etc.
  • Participate in achieving individual and branch goals.
  • Work with team members to drive a high accountability and fun organizational culture.
  • Share your knowledge and ideas on everything from effective practices to ways we can better support our membership and our team.
  • Other duties as assigned.
Qualifications:
  • One to three years of customer service experience
  • Previous leadership experience and can exhibit strong leadership skills
  • A high school education or GED.

This is a full-time, non-exempt position with an hourly rate starting at $18.50/hour, depending on experience, education and qualifications.
